About Agency

Overview

  • NuPower North Recruiting was founded in 2005 and operates in Toronto, Ontario, Canada, specializing in recruitment for IT sales organizations.
  • Managing Partner Barry Frydman brings 12 years of partner relationship management experience from Sun Microsystems, working with Canadian System Integrators, VARs, and software developers.
  • Barry Frydman has direct sales leadership experience at IBM, Sun Microsystems, Wang, Prime Computer, and Data General, focusing on IT sales since 2005.
  • The company maintains close relationships with a small network of North American IT sales organizations and seasoned professionals to optimize recruitment outcomes.
  • NuPower North Recruiting has operated for seven years under Barry Frydman, leveraging his IT sales expertise to connect top performers with high-growth companies.
